Jazzing up Greek salad with canned tuna

Incorporating canned tuna into a Greek salad elevates it from a basic side dish to a satisfying and hearty lunch. Since we’re already stepping away from tradition, why not enhance it further by adding some complementary ingredients to your tuna-topped salad?
Given that the focus of this salad is on canned items, consider including canned or jarred marinated artichoke hearts. These edible thistles will introduce an earthy richness that harmonizes beautifully with the tuna and other Mediterranean flavors. For an extra protein boost, toss in some crispy, herb-roasted chickpeas, which can serve as a delightful alternative to croutons. If you prefer, traditional croutons made from pita bread are also a great option. To add a touch of briny flavor that pairs well with the tuna, a sprinkle of capers can brighten the dish. For a simple yet impactful twist, replace regular red onions with pickled red onions to give the salad a zesty kick.
Whether you choose to keep it straightforward or embellish it with additional ingredients, a Greek salad topped with canned tuna is an easy way to increase its protein content without losing its classic appeal. Once you give it a try, you’ll never view a standard Greek salad the same way again.
